Output a8babfc1fa6bcb9d16774655a0c6290bc33eb6f64cd78c77aa94bfcf53639e4a:1

value
383056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1627cc84a662132dc842fe937a551f7919b6f9b OP_EQUAL
address
3Ln98fQaLpVPwjBuzFEqvHLtr438xYMDRT
transaction
a8babfc1fa6bcb9d16774655a0c6290bc33eb6f64cd78c77aa94bfcf53639e4a